中国传统节日(中英文对照简介)目录The Spring Festiveil (春节)Lan ter n Festival (元宵节)Qingming Festival (清明节)Dragon Boat Festival (端午节)Double Seventh Festival (七夕)Mid-Autumn Festival (中秋节)Double Ninth Festival (重阳节)Winter Solstice Festival (冬至)Spring Festival Lanteni Festival Qingming FestivalDragon Boat Festival Double SeventhFestivalMid-Autinmi FestivalDouble Ninth Festival Winter SolsticeFestivalThe Spring Festival (春节)The first day of the first lunar month is the New Year in the Chinese lunar calendar・ Among the traditional Chinese festivals, this is the most importa nt and the most bustl ing・ Since it occurs at the end of win ter and the beginning of spring. people also call it the Spring Festiva1. Chinese have many traditional customs relating to the Spring Festiva1・ Since the 23rd day of the 12th lunar montha, people start to prepare for the eve nt. Every family will undertake thorough cleaning, do their Spring Festival shopping, create paper-cuts for window decoration, put up New Year picturesb, write Spring Festival coupletsc, make New Year cakesd, and also prepare all kinds of food to bid farewell to the old and usher in the new・New Year r s Eve is the time for a happy reunion of all family members, when they sit around the table to have a sumptuous New Year1s Eve dinner, talking and laughing, until daybreak, which is called ”staying up to see the year out H. When the bell tolls mid night on New Year* s Eve, people eat dumplings・ In ancient times, midnight was called zishi (a period of the day from 11 p・ m. to 1 a・ m.)・ Dumplings (jiaozi) are eaten because it sounds the same as change of the year and the day" in Chinese・From the first day of the lunar year, people pay New Year calls on relatives and friends, which is an important custom for the Spring Festiva1.Setting off firecrackers is the favorite activity of children in the Spring Festival. According to legend, this could drive off evil spirits・The continuous sound of firecrackers can be heard everywhere, adding to the atmosphere of rejoicing and festivity・Many places hold temple fairs ・ The wonderful drag on lantern dance and the lion dance per forma nces, along with various han dicraft articles and local snacks attract thousands of people・With the development of the times, some changes have taken place in the customs of spending the Spring Festiva1. For example, to prevent environmental pollution, many cities have banned firecrackers・But this does not have an impact on the happy atmosphere of the festival. On NewYear1s Eve, family members get together to have dinner whi1e watching TV programs.For Chinese at home and abroad, the Spring Festival is always the most important festival.农历的正(zheng)月初一,是中国的农历新年。

Hou Yi shoots down nine suns.
后羿射日
According to Chinese mythology, the earth once had 10 suns circling over it. One day, all 10 suns appeared together, scorching the earth with their heat. The earth was saved when a strong archer, Hou Yi, succeeded in shooting down 9 of the suns. Yi stole the elixir(长生药) of life to save the people from his tyrannical rule, but his wife, Chang-E drank it. Thus started the legend of the lady in the moon to whom young Chinese girls would pray at the MidAutumn Festival.

The mid autumn festival
The mid autumn festival is a traditional festival of China, which falls on the fifteenth of the eighth month of Chinese lunar calendar. It is to celebrate the harvest of a year and for the family to reunite. To some extent, it is like Thanks- giving day in western countries. People are grateful because their food is gathered for the winter and the agricultural work is over. Family members usually get together and offer sacrifices to the moon. when the moon arises, people will sit in the yard,admiring the full moon, enjoying delicious moon-cakes and fruit, talking about a year’s harvest, Looking back to the past and looking into the future. It is a time of pleasure, happiness and reunion.

The Spring Festival is the most important festival in China. It’s to celebrate the lunar calendar’s New Year. The festiva l actually begins on the eve of the lunar New Year and ends on the 15th day of the first month of the lunar calendar, which is called the Lantern Festival. Before the festival, people usually give their houses a thorough cleaning, do a lot of shopping and prepare a lot of delicious food. People put New Year couplets on the wall and hang red lantern for good fortune. On the New Year’s Eve, families get together and have a big meal. Dumplings, minced noodles and fish are the most traditional food. They stand for treasure, long life and abundance. Children like the festival best, because they can have delicious food, wear new clothes,
set off firecrackers. They can also get gift/lucky money in red packets from elders. The Spring Festival lasts about 15 days long. During the festival, People get together to eat, drink, and have fun with each other. The festival let people enjoy life and have a good rest.
The lively atmosphere not only fills every household, but fills streets and lanes.
A series of activities such as lion dancing, dragon dancing, lantern shows, land boat dancing and temple fairs are held for days. The Spring Festival then comes to an end when the Lantern Festival is finished.。
